Field Sales Job Overview: The Brand Ambassador, Craft will be responsible for leading education, advocacy, and commercial activation for the Rémy Cointreau portfolio in Chicago. This role is program-heavy, requiring strong execution of masterclasses, staff trainings, and brand experiences, while also translating influence into commercial impact through menu features, placements, and distribution. The ideal candidate is entrepreneurial, opportunity-driven, and highly connected within the local hospitality community. They excel at commanding a room, inspiring trade partners, and collaborating with distributor and sales teams to ensure advocacy translates into measurable business results. This position is based in Chicago and reports to the Advocacy Director. Brands:

Rémy Martin 1738, Cointreau, The Botanist, Mount Gay, Westland, Bruichladdich, and other portfolio brands (excluding Louis XIII). Job Responsibilities: Activation & Advocacy

Lead impactful trainings, masterclasses, and education sessions for trade, distributor partners, and staff. Build relationships with 50–75 key on-premise accounts to expand brand visibility and advocacy. Execute KPI’s with target brands in specific accounts that locally identify with each brand Drive recruitment and participation in localized experiential programs. Act as the in-market face of the portfolio, building excitement and influence within the Chicago bar and restaurant community. Drive menu placements and features year-round on all brands within portfolio that cater to local market trends and specific accounts Increase brand visibility based on account level needs Create opportunities locally to best represent the RC portfolio Commercial Growth Influence sales by driving menu placements, features, and distribution in target accounts. Partner with distributor and RCUSA sales teams on account planning, activation, and KPI delivery. Proactively grow the business by aligning brand programming with commercial opportunities. Analyze local sales data and trends to uncover growth opportunities. Administrative & Reporting Manage budgets, POS allocation, expenses, and activation resources with accountability. Submit weekly pre-plans, monthly recaps, and quarterly reviews highlighting successes and opportunities. Maintain accurate CRM reporting, sales tracking, and program recaps. Job Qualifications: 3–5 years of relevant experience in on-premise sales, advocacy, or trade marketing. Strong connections and credibility within Chicago’s hospitality/bar community. Proven ability to manage relationships, budgets, and multiple projects simultaneously. Exceptional public speaking and presentation skills; able to energize and influence audiences. Marketing or event activation experience a plus. Entrepreneurial, self-starter mindset; thrives on challenges and growth opportunities. Computer savvy; proficient in CRM systems, reporting, and expense management tools. Must be 21+ with valid driver’s license and solicitor’s permit (as required by law).
